Bone Curette Hemingway N.4


Clinical Overview
The Bone Curette Hemingway N.4 is a double-ended surgical instrument designed for use in small bone and periodontal procedures. Its oval, cupped tips with sharp edges facilitate the effective scraping away of bone fragments, making it suitable for debulking applications.

Indications
- Debulking of small bone fragments.
- Periodontal surgical procedures.
- Bone grafting preparation.
- Accessing and cleaning bone surfaces.
Instructions for Use
- Select the appropriate end of the curette based on the surgical site.
- Gently insert the tip into the area requiring bone removal.
- Utilize a scraping motion to remove bone fragments effectively.
- Periodically assess the area to ensure thorough cleaning.
- Clean and sterilize the instrument after use according to standard protocols.
